The production of Brace Face Betty is rooted in HOLYWATER’s technology-driven content ecosystem — an integrated pipeline that allows us to create, test, and scale vertical series with exceptional speed and precision. My Drama operates alongside two other platforms: My Passion, the #1 independent digital book publishing platform among non-Chinese companies, and My Muse, the leading vertical streaming app for AI-generated series. This ecosystem enables us to identify high-potential stories early, refine them through iterative testing and audience feedback and bring only the strongest concepts into full live-action production.
Our content pipeline works in three stages:
1. Story Discovery on My Passion: we test hundreds of exclusive books and analyze real-time viewer behavior to understand which themes, characters, and emotional arcs resonate most. Stories that exceed performance benchmarks advance to the next stage.
2. AI Pre-Production on My Muse: selected stories usually become AI-generated pilots or short-form series. This allows us to test the script, pacing, and visual direction before committing to live-action production. Audience reactions help shape everything from character presentation to cliffhanger structures.
3. Cinematic Live-Action Production for My Drama: concepts validated by data and user engagement move into full production.
Brace Face Betty followed this exact process, informed by audience insights at every development stage.
Brace Face Betty is a young adult drama following shy, braces-wearing Betty, who becomes the target of her ruthless stepsister. When Marcus — the school's charismatic bad boy — unexpectedly takes interest, Betty is thrust into a whirlwind of secrets, power plays, and unexpected romance. As betrayals escalate, she must decide whether to fight back or be crushed. This heightened emotional landscape made it an ideal candidate for the fast-paced vertical format.
For Brace Face Betty, we focused on transforming classic YA tropes into a fast-paced vertical feature film. Our team crafted mobile-first compositions, dynamic lighting, and color grading optimized for small screens. Each 1–2 minute episode was engineered for maximum engagement—clear emotional beats, rapid pacing, and structurally strong cliffhangers—creating a feature-length story designed specifically for vertical viewing.

Brace Face Betty delivered exceptional results and quickly became one of My Drama’s top-performing titles. The series recorded a record-breaking premiere, generated 824 million impressions through its marketing campaign, and ranked among the most-watched vertical series globally in Q2 2025 (SocialPeta).
The title proved that school romance — a genre previously underexplored in vertical storytelling — has strong audience demand. Viewer behavior showed high replay rates and strong emotional engagement, validating early insights from My Passion’s data testing.
The series also earned industry recognition, receiving the Audience Favorite Award at the Vertical Shorts Festival and becoming a semi-finalist at the Canada Shorts Festival, further cementing its impact.
